About the Author
Barry Tagrin is the founding director of Hellenic International Studies in the Arts and head of its poetry center and Writer In Residence Program. A graduate of San Francisco State s writing program in 1974, he was an original member of the San Francisco Poetry Group, along with Jack Gilbert, Linda Gregg, Larry Felson, and others. As poet, painter, and teacher, he has lived and worked internationally in Spain, Algeria, Denmark, Malaysia and Japan, finally settling in Greece, where he now lives with his Japanese wife and new daughter, Mona.
